Best exercise option for tracking basketball with Inspire HR?

I noticed that on the exercise shortcuts for the Inspire HR, basketball is not listed as a shortcut. Which of the available shortcuts would be best suited for tracking basketball? Workout? Aerobic workout? Please share your thoughts.

 

I know there is autotrack, but I think there will be time where I explicitly want to track it.

When an Activity is not there used Workout mode. Then you can rename it to what you want. Basketball is listed under the exercise tab just not on the shortcuts. So you do not need to set up a custom one to rename it

@ancilla   Auto recognition and basketball won't work well as a option.  The auto recognition feature works best with a continuous activity like walk, run, bike.  In basketball, you go back and forth between playing and being on the bench.  The auto recognition has a default 15 minute activity time before recognition.  You can set it to 10 minutes.  But I think you will miss some of the details you want if you use auto recognition.  You might miss some time periods.
